One Case of Scrotal Inflammation with Local Necrosis Caused by Dapagliflozin Tablets

Abstract: Objective To analyze the clinical characteristics and treatments of scrotal inflammation with local necrosis induced by dapagliflozin so as to provide a reference for safe clinical practice. Methods One case of scrotal inflammation with local necrosis induced by dapagliflozin was analyzed and the possible mechanism, clinical characteristics, and treatment regimens were investigated based on literature. Results After 4 months of taking dapagliflozin, the patient developed epididymo-orchitis. Related literature and time correlations of medication suggested that this symptom might have been caused by dapagliflozin. The patient was discharged after right testicular epididymis resection under intraspinal anesthesia. Conclusion When dapagliflozin is used in clinic, clinicians need to alert to adverse reactions in the urogenital system, which may lead to surgery or even threaten life if left untreated.
